Energetics, Structure and Molecular Interactions


We study the gas phase reactivity, energetic, interactions and structure of neutral and ionic species with fundamental, biological and technological relevance. For this purpose we use a variety of experimental (Tandem hybrid Triple Quadrupole / FT-ICR Mass Spectrometer, calorimetry of combustion, Knudsen's effusion technique, PEPICO photoion/photoelectron coincidence spectrometry) and computational methods. The combination of the experimental results with those obtained by means of quantum-mechanic calculations (ab-initio, DFT, etc.) have allowed us: i)To obtain quantitative information on thermodynamic and kinetic of a variety of ion-molecule reactions. ii) To determine interesting and novel relationship of energy/structure and chemical reactivity. iii) To determine the thermodynamic stability of neutral and ionic species. iv) To discover new species and new types of chemical bonds.
